Okay. I do not know anything about phones. As to number 1, how do i back up everything on the phone before i start trying anything? |
|
|
|
Cirruslyloud
Age :
40Number of posts :
1572My Device :
Samsung RANTCarrier :
Sprint PCSLocation :
MI
|
Tue Sep 16, 2008 3:13 am
|
|
Do you sync with outlook? Basically, to back up your contacts and calender entries you'll have to sync your phone with Activesync (Windows XP) or Windows Mobile Device Center (Windows Vista). If you do not have either of these then a quick google search should turn up some download links.
After you've installed either of the above, simply plug your phone into a USB port on your computer and follow the on-screen prompts. It will have you select what you'd like to sync with your PC.
After the upgrade, if all goes well..... you'll have Windows Mobile 6.1 and you can then proceed to sync your contacts, etc. back to your phone.
Any other questions feel free. Follow the tutorial to the "T" and you should have no troubles at all.
